Information on the Target

Irth Solutions, headquartered in Columbus, Ohio, is a prominent provider of enterprise software tailored for critical energy and infrastructure industries. Established in 1985, Irth specializes in delivering cloud-based software solutions that merge geospatial data with business intelligence and artificial intelligence (AI). This integration offers comprehensive situational awareness for infrastructure operators, enabling them to proactively identify, mitigate, and manage risks.

Irth's mission-critical solutions are utilized by some of the largest energy, utility, and telecommunications providers across the nation. The platform caters to over 20,000 daily users and processes more than 130 million work orders, along with generating 500 million AI insights annually. This functionality aids in detecting potential weaknesses and implementing timely resolutions, ensuring the operational integrity of critical network infrastructures.

The Rationale Behind the Deal

The acquisition of Irth Solutions by TPG is poised to enhance the company’s ability to deliver significant value to its clients in the energy, utility, and telecommunications sectors. With TPG’s extensive expertise in software, AI, and infrastructure, the partnership aims to accelerate innovation and expand Irth’s offerings, fostering enhanced resilience and reliability for its clientele.

This strategic alliance reflects TPG’s commitment to backing mission-critical software businesses. By empowering Irth with the necessary resources and support, TPG intends to strengthen the company's capabilities in addressing the evolving challenges faced by critical infrastructure operators in an increasingly complex environment.

Information about the Investor

TPG is a leading global alternative asset management firm, founded in San Francisco in 1992. With approximately $261 billion in assets under management, TPG operates through a diversified set of investment strategies, which include private equity, impact investing, credit, real estate, and market solutions. The firm's operational philosophy emphasizes collaboration, innovation, and inclusion, contributing to its long-term success in generating value for investors and portfolio companies.
